People think making their website greener means losing their brand aesthetic, reducing content or pages, removing videos and images, and not having the whizz-bang of 3D or animations, and that’s why we talk about priorities.
When redesigning Abstrakt’s website, we knew we wanted an elevated website showcasing our capabilities with 3D, transitions, and deeply insightful pages about our core offerings in Craft CMS and digital brand identity. We knew our project pages needed to sing the most.
That meant designing and developing pages that were carbon-heavy with elements such as:
Animations or videos
High-resolution images
3D motion in our heroes
Large blocks of written content
Our carbon conscious take on this was to introduce:
Designing heavier pages with black backgrounds which emits less energy
A more minimalistic approach to our article overview and article pages
Using fewer fonts and font weights and self-hosting them
Image optimisation and compression using .webp files
Being purposeful with any animation used on-site
A green SEO strategy targeting user intent
Reducing server requests where possible
Streamlined user journeys
Regular content culls
Static page caching
Green hosting
